The Planetary Invasion Syndicate has called upon Alien Babarue Babaryu to impersonate Ultraman Orb and ruin his reputation as Earth's savior. But while Babaryu tried to do so, the spontaneous appearance of a Telesdon ruined the plan and left Babaryu to fend for himself. During that time, he accidentally shielded the children from Telesdon before the monster got away and him retreating in his human. By mistake, Jetta believed him as the real Orb and had him played with several children. When the Planetary Invasion Syndicate ordered Babaryu to resume his activity, he refused due to his time as a human gave him a change of heart and fought a Cherubim summoned by Jugglus before the real Orb appeared and destroy it. Although exposed as an impostor, Babaryu was thanked by Jetta and several children before he disappeared and was revealed to have restart his new life as a cleaner.

Gai was able to save Naomi moments before Jugglus assassinate her. Taking shelter in a warehouse, Gai discovers from Naomi's salvaged matryoshka that Natasha survived the explosion in Rusalka and moved to Japan, with Naomi was revealed to be her descendant. While VTL Squad labels Orb as a public enemy, Juggler brought Zeppandon and challenged Gai again. Having no longer fear of darkness, Gai utilizes Thunder Breastar in full control and fought Zeppandon despite being targets of Z-VTOL squadron. Naomi bravely approached Orb and declared that she has no fear for him and thanks the giant for saving her before. As Zeppandon open fires at Orb, the Ultra shielded the SSP members, allowing him to regain his reputation. Naomi hums Gai's melody for him to regain faith on himself and finally helping Orb regains his true form, Orb Origin. Zeppandon was defeated by the Ultraman's new strength and caused Juggler to lose his Dark Ring.

Sometime later, Naomi slowly recovers from her injuries but the news of her being Galactron's victim caught the attention of multiple newscaster. Apart from that, Orb's notoriety in both knocking out a Z-VTOL and inability to save Naomi earn him a notoriety in the public. While visiting Naomi, Jetta and Shin revealed her of a footage from a mysterious explosion in Rusalka 108 years ago from a mysterious explosion, hinting that aside from Orb, other Ultraman existed. It was also then where Keiko revealed to Naomi of her great-great-grandmother originated from Rusalka before migrating to Japan. Gai visited Rusalka and recollected the events from 108 years prior where he was saved by Natasha, a girl he soon befriended until she died in a crossfire between Ultraman Orb and Maga-Zetton. Juggler expected Gai's arrival and revealed Maga-Orochi's tail that Orb as Thunder Breastar yanked off a long time ago to combine it with the cards of Zetton and Pandon, forming Zeppandon. Orb faced this monster but to no avail as Juggler coerce him to use Belial's power again. Still refusing Thunder Breastar's power, he used Burnmite's Stobium Dynamite and escape the battle, meeting Natasha's spirit, who transformed into Naomi's look-alike to give Gai a blank card before leaving. Meanwhile in Japan, Juggler made his way to Naomi's ward.

Jugglus Juggler introduced himself to a group of invading aliens called Planetary Invasion Syndicate and proposes an alliance. Meanwhile, Shibukawa seeks the help from SSP of reports of a UFO sightings in a forbidden forest, which was stated in an urban legend that nobody has ever get out survived. While wandering in the forest, SSP and Shibukawa are under attacked by Alien Nackle Nagus, who brought along two other henchmen as they trapped the entire forest into a dimensional subspace and planned to kill them for intruding their hideout. Although managed to escape thanks to the Princess Tamayura, SSP and Shibukawa are still targeted until Gai arrives and rescue them. Jugglus summons Aribunta for the Planetary Invasion Syndicate to escape while said Super Beast was killed by Ultraman Orb. After the battle, while Jugglus take his leave, the syndicate's leader, Don Nostra, plans to betray Jugglus and claim his possession of King Demon Beast Monster Cards while holding an Ultraman Belial Ultra Fusion Card. Jugglus simply watched the group's saucer departing and is well aware of their leader's treacherous plot on him.
